Understanding the Federal Technical Data Solution: A Legal Overview
Definition & meaning
The Federal Technical Data Solution (FedTeDS) is an online platform that integrates with the Governmentwide Point of Entry (GPE) and the Central Contractor Registration (CCR) system. It is used for distributing information about contract opportunities. The primary purpose of FedTeDS is to improve access control and manage the distribution of solicitation documents in accordance with agency procedures. This ensures that sensitive information is only available to authorized users.

FedTeDS is primarily utilized in the realm of federal procurement and contracting. It is relevant for government agencies, contractors, and vendors who seek to participate in government contracts. Understanding how to access and use FedTeDS can be crucial for those involved in federal contracting, as it provides a centralized location for solicitation documents and contract opportunities.
